Unnamed Rutians
The following is a list of unnamed Rutians.
Ansata bomber
This individual was responsible for setting a bomb which destroyed a shuttlebus, resulting in the deaths of 60 schoolchildren. They were described as being a "teenager". Months later, this person's age was used as a reason by Alexana Devos for her rationale that children associated with the Ansata were a threat. (TNG: "The High Ground")
Ansata members and sympathizers
According to Alexana Devos, out of over five thousand names on a list, roughly two hundred were Ansata members, with several thousand sympathizers who supplied them with weapons and information, marched in demonstrations supporting the group, and took part in riots. (TNG: "The High Ground")
Ansata terrorists
These terrorists were members of the Ansata. They kidnapped Dr. Beverly Crusher from the Rutian plaza following an explosion. Later they transported aboard the USS Enterprise-D, fired at several crewmembers and placed a bomb near the warp core. Chief Engineer Geordi La Forge was able to remove the explosive. Following this, the kidnappers transported onto the bridge of the vessel, shot at Worf, and kidnapped Captain Jean-Luc Picard.
They were overwhelmed when combined forces of the Rutian police and Starfleet beamed into their hiding place and Alexana Devos shot their leader Kyril Finn, killing him. (TNG: "The High Ground")












Bombing suspects
These three suspects were detained for questioning after the bombing of a cafe, and the kidnapping of Dr. Crusher by the Ansata, a rebel group. Commander Riker was shocked when he saw the two boys being arrested, and was told by Alexana Devos that a recent bombing on a shuttle bus was perpetrated by a teenager. It is unknown whether any of these individuals were members of the resistance group, were otherwise sympathetic to their cause or were innocent. (TNG: "The High Ground")
Boy
A Rutian boy
This boy was a member of a rebel group known as Ansata.
He helped Doctor Beverly Crusher treat Ansata members who were dying from the effects of using a dimensional shifter, which caused a breakdown in the DNA of anyone who uses it. After Alexana Devos killed Kyril Finn, the leader of the Ansata, who had kidnapped Dr. Crusher, the Rutian boy aimed a phaser rifle at Alexana, but Dr. Crusher told him the killing had to end. After considering her words, the child surrendered.
Alexana stated that he was another to take Finn's place, but Commander Riker commented that maybe the end of hostilities could start with the boy putting down his phaser. (TNG: "The High Ground")

Devos' bodyguards
These two police officers served as bodyguards for Alexana Devos in 2366. They accompanied her to the Rutian plaza following a bomb explosion. When an Ansata terrorist appeared they protected her. They were also present when Devos and Commander Riker interrogated Katik Shaw and later beamed into the underground hiding place of the terrorists. (TNG: "The High Ground")


Devos' predecessors
The former police chiefs of Rutia IV prior to Alexana Devos used methods that were more severe than hers; Devos stated that they weremurdered. (TNG: "The High Ground")
Finn's son
Finn's son was the offspring of the Ansata leader Kyril Finn. At thirteen years of age, Finn's son died in police detention. (TNG: "The High Ground")

School children
These 60 school children died as a result of the bombing of a shuttlebus a few days after Alexana Devos' arrival. The Ansata claimed their chosen target was a police transport and that the children's deaths were a mistake. It was their deaths that caused Devos to vow to put an end to terrorism in her city. (TNG: "The High Ground")
Suffering Ansata
These terrorists were members of the Ansata who suffered from the effects of the transport through a dimensional shift by using the inverters. Dr. Beverly Crusher was kidnapped by the Ansata to treat them but was unable because of the cellular damage caused by the transport device. (TNG: "The High Ground")




"Vanished" suspects
According to Devos, during the reign of her predecessors, suspects would be brought into custody, only to mysteriously disappear. She ended that practice. (TNG: "The High Ground")
